Output 3ca532fa661c4bee9ec82174a36c0343bb967ab3262e016b15497a575ae3e0ae:0

value
92672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b438e565b8549c8503e8a8bc09731705d776c358 OP_EQUAL
address
3J7wiHLGaZFDdkkSz3uBEdzfGuTSVtCwaR
transaction
3ca532fa661c4bee9ec82174a36c0343bb967ab3262e016b15497a575ae3e0ae
confirmations
289790
spent
true